Maintaining motivation to be a non-smoker and staying on track requires ongoing effort and commitment.

Here are some techniques to help:

Staying Motivated:

1. Celebrate milestones: Celebrate small milestones, such as reaching a week or a month without smoking, to stay motivated and encouraged.

2. Remind yourself of the benefits: Reflect on the benefits of quitting smoking, such as improved health, increased energy, and fresher breath.

3. Find healthy alternatives: Engage in healthy activities, such as exercise, hobbies, or spending time with friends and family, to distract from cravings.

Setting Goals:

1. Set specific goals: Set specific, measurable, and achievable goals for staying smoke-free.

2. Create a quit plan: Develop a quit plan that includes coping strategies, support systems, and rewards.

3. Track progress: Track progress and reflect on experiences to identify areas for improvement.

Staying Connected with Support Systems:

1. Join a support group: Join a support group, such as Nicotine Anonymous, to connect with others who have quit smoking.

2. Seek counseling: Seek counseling or therapy to address underlying issues and develop coping strategies.

3. Stay in touch with friends and family: Stay in touch with friends and family who can provide encouragement and support.

Managing Cravings:

1. Identify triggers: Be aware of situations, emotions, or people that trigger cravings.

2. Develop coping strategies: Use healthy coping mechanisms, such as deep breathing, meditation, or journaling, to manage cravings.
